II. Exploring the Different Types of Outdoor Business Signs
A. Traditional Signs: Billboards, A-frames, and Banners
In the overwhelming world of advertising, sometimes going old school can serve you well. Traditional outdoor signs such as billboards, A-frames, and banners have that old-world charm that still raises eyebrows. Billboards, large & visible, are like big screens advertising your business. A-frames, on the other hand, are compact, movable, and great for sidewalk advertising. And banners? Let's just say they're like your business's very own flag—prominently announcing your business’s presence.
B. Digital Signs: LED and LCD Displays
In the era of tech, not harnessing the power of digital signs is a cardinal sin. LED signs are energy-efficient, long-lasting, and have that "light-me-up" feature that's hard to ignore. LCDs too, with their superior picture quality and flexible content update feature, make a great choice for your outdoor business sign needs.
C. Custom Signs: Monuments, Pylons, and Vehicle Wraps
Sometimes, to make a powerful statement, you've got to customize! Monument signs at the entrance make your business feel more established and trustworthy. Meanwhile, pylon signs stand tall, inviting attention even from afar. And vehicle wraps? Well, they're your moving billboards carrying your business message across town, literally!

Frequently Asked Questions
- What is the average cost of outdoor business signs in Connecticut?
It varies based on size, design, material, and type ranging from a few hundred to thousands of dollars. Consulting your signage provider would fetch you a more accurate estimate.
- How long does it take to install an outdoor business sign?
Once the design is approved, it may take anywhere between a few days to several weeks for production and installation, depending on the complexity and type of sign.
- Are there any restrictions on digital or animated signs within Connecticut?
Yes, CT legislation has restrictions on the size, brightness, and content-change interval for digital and animated signs. Check with your local governing body for specific rules applicable to your location.
